The Metropolitan Museum of Art recently announced the Costume Institute’s spring 2025 exhibition, “Superfine: Tailoring Black Style.” Inspired by Monica L. Miller’s book, Slaves to Fashion: Black Dandyism and the Styling of Black Diasporic Identity, the exhibit will showcase the style of Black men through garments, paintings, photographs, and more, from the 18th century to modern times. The co-chairs of the 2025 Met Gala, including Colman Domingo, Lewis Hamilton, A$AP Rocky, Pharrell Williams, and Anna Wintour, along with honorary chair LeBron James, are a perfect fit for the theme of the exhibition.

The 2025 Met Gala, set to take place on the first Monday in May, is highly anticipated by fashion enthusiasts.
